Definition (Exam Point):IoT is a network of physical devices embedded with sensors, software, and internet connectivity that enables them to collect and exchange data.
IoT Components
Sensors/DevicesInternet ConnectivityData Processing (Cloud/Server)User Interface (Mobile App/Web)IoT के Applications
Smart HomeSmart CityHealthcareAgricultureIndustrial AutomationSmart Transportation
Advantages of IoT-
Automation
Real-time monitoring
Increased efficiency
Reduced operational cost
Better decision-making
Disadvantages of IoT -
Security and privacy risks
High implementation cost
Dependence on the Internet
Data management challenges
